157 Candidates has been announced by BJP for Bengal in Second List

On March 18, 2021, various protests have broken out once in Bengal again after the BJP announced its final list of candidates for the Bengal election. The BJP has announced 148 candidates on Thursday. Overall 157 names have been announced.
As per the reports, nine former Trinamool MLA have got tickets from the BJP. This clearly has ruffled many feathers the names announced for the fifth, sixth, seventh, and eighth phase of the Bengal election. Interestingly, Dilip Ghosh has not been contesting the assembly polls.
He’s not going to contest but however, some big names will be Mukul Roy. He’s been included and his son is also going to contest. Mukul is fighting elections from Krishnanagar North in the Nadia district. One more MP has been fielded taking the total number of MPs who’ve been fielded in a local election to fight BJP MP Jagannath Sarkar is going to be contesting from Santipur in Nadia.
The other MPs include Babul Supriyo and Locket Chatterjee. This is a breakup as far as the list is concerned. Meanwhile, interesting developments have actually taken place yesterday because BJP workers have been protesting after the list was announced.
This happened when the first list was announced as well. After these protests, the BJP is reacted. They have changed their candidate from Alipurduar and haven’t in fact replaced the eminent economist Ashok Lahiri with a local candidate so Lahiri’s candidacy was being contested.
The BJP protests took place yesterday. He was given a ticket from the Alipurduar seat and now a local candidate Suman Kanjilal has been given the ticket instead.
